Four Academy graduates - Angus Baker, Harrison Carr, Jarrod Osborne and Luke Robertson - have chosen to take up offers from the Canberra Demons, while Will Gowers is moving to Queensland to play for Aspley. Since its inception for the 2011 season, about 2400 youngsters have come through the academy with 12 breaking through for a senior game. Sydney fielded a record five Academy graduates in Round 19, 2017, which saw Heeney, Mills, Sam Naismith, Dan Robinson and Jordan Foote meet Hawthorn at the MCG. The Sydney Swans are hosting a First Nations Academy trial, presented by SafetyCulture, which is a ten-week sporting program designed to not only increase the participation and involvement of First Nations People across the whole of game but also identify those with the physical capabilities and character to become a high-performing athlete.
